- Fórum WMO
- → hicksteinlab's Content
hicksteinlab's Content
There have been 15 items by hicksteinlab (Search limited from 28/04/2023)
#429566 Msde
Posted by hicksteinlab on 21/08/2004, 14:34 in Outras Linguagens e Tecnologias
acho, mas não tenho certeza, de que a aplicação rodaria tranquilamente em SQLServer pois o MSDE é apenas, uma versão mais leve...com um limite de 5 conexções simultâneas...
você baixou pelo site www.asp.net o MSDE SP3? Realmente é um pouquinho complicado instalá-lo, porém há alguns sites com passo a passo para esta instalação...dê uma olhadinha no google!
Espero ter ajudado...Abs,
Leonardo Hickstein
Hickstein Lab
#424892 Página: Cadastro
Posted by hicksteinlab on 13/08/2004, 12:37 in .NET
no VS.NET as coisas mudam um pouquinho...
-> o HTML fica separado do código C#;
-> o HTML fica na .aspx e o C# fica na .aspx.cs;
-> seria bom, se você lêsse algo, sobre como as coisas funcionam em VS.NET;
-> eu até poderia te explicar, mas a conversa seria imensamente longa...então leia algo, e ai sim, te ajudarei no que precisares, ok?
Espero ter ajudado...abs,
Leonardo Hickstein
Hickstein Lab
#424246 Página: Cadastro
Posted by hicksteinlab on 12/08/2004, 11:46 in .NET
eu fiz ele p/ você usar ele no WebMatrix, com certeza se vc copiar e colar p/ dentro do VS.NET ele não vai funcionar, porém se nos formos passo a passo, tu me indicando os erros q aparece eu possa te ajudar....
Abraços,
Leonardo Hickstein
Hickstein Lab
#423870 Página: Cadastro
Posted by hicksteinlab on 11/08/2004, 18:54 in .NET
já que pediu, lá vai um exemplo:
<%@ Page Language="C#" Debug="true" %> <%@ Register TagPrefix="wmx" Namespace="Microsoft.Matrix.Framework.Web.UI" Assembly="Microsoft.Matrix.Framework, Version=0.6.0.0, Culture=neutral, PublicKeyToken=6f763c9966660626" %> <%@ import Namespace="System.Data" %> <%@ import Namespace="System.Data.OleDb" %> <script runat="server"> void btnLimparCampos_Click(object sender, EventArgs e) { tbNome.Text = tbEmail.Text = tbLogin.Text = tbSenha.Text = ""; } void btnCadastrarUsuario_Click(object sender, EventArgs e) { // Recupera os valores entrados pelo usuário string s_Nome = this.tbNome.Text; string s_Email = this.tbEmail.Text; string s_Login = this.tbLogin.Text; string s_Senha = this.tbSenha.Text; // Cria a string de conexão string s_Conexao =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" + Server.MapPath("Teste.mdb"); // Cria um objeto de conexão e como parâmetro a string de conexão OleDbConnection o_Conn = new OleDbConnection(s_Conexao); // Cria a string de sql string s_SQL = "INSERT INTO Cadastros (Nome, Email, Login, Senha) " + "VALUES ('" + s_Nome + "', '" + s_Email + "', '" + s_Login + "', '" + s_Senha + "')"; // Cria um objeto para executar comandos contra o banco, // tal como inserir valores, com 2 parâmetros // 1º: a string de SQL // 2º: o objeto para conexão OleDbCommand o_Cmd = new OleDbCommand(s_SQL, o_Conn); try { o_Conn.Open(); o_Cmd.ExecuteNonQuery(); // Limpa os campos tbNome.Text = tbEmail.Text = tbLogin.Text = tbSenha.Text = ""; // Exibe uma mensagem de sucesso Response.Write("Cadastro efetuado com sucesso!"); } catch (OleDbException _Erro) { Response.Write("O seguinte erro foi constatado ao tentar inserir um registro junto ao banco!" + _Erro.Message + "<br />"); } finally { if (o_Conn != null) { o_Conn.Close(); } } } </script> <html> <head> <title>CADASTRO DE USUÁRIOS - VERSÃO 1.0</title> </head> <body> <form runat="server"> <table cellspacing="0" cellpadding="0" width="50%" align="center" border="0"> <tbody> <tr> <td colspan="2"> <h1>Cadastro de Usuários: </h1> <hr /> </td> </tr> <tr> <td width="30%"> Nome:</td> <td width="70%"> <asp:TextBox id="tbNome" runat="server" width="100%"></asp:TextBox> </td> </tr> <tr> <td width="30%"> Email:</td> <td width="70%"> <asp:TextBox id="tbEmail" runat="server" width="100%"></asp:TextBox> </td> </tr> <tr> <td width="30%"> Login:</td> <td width="70%"> <asp:TextBox id="tbLogin" runat="server" width="100%"></asp:TextBox> </td> </tr> <tr> <td width="30%"> Senha:</td> <td width="70%"> <asp:TextBox id="tbSenha" runat="server" width="100%" TextMode="Password"></asp:TextBox> </td> </tr> <tr><td colspan="2"><hr /></td></tr> <tr> <td align="right"> <asp:Button id="btnLimparCampos" onclick="btnLimparCampos_Click" runat="server" Text="Limpar Campos"></asp:Button> </td> <td align="left"> <asp:Button id="btnCadastrarUsuario" onclick="btnCadastrarUsuario_Click" runat="server" Text="Cadastrar Usuário"></asp:Button> </td> </tr> </tbody> </table> </form> </body> </html>
Espero ter ajudado...abs,
Leonardo Hickstein
Hickstein Lab
#421723 Página: Cadastro
Posted by hicksteinlab on 08/08/2004, 13:34 in .NET
Pelo erro que estou vendo, o que acontece, é que você está tentando retornar um valor...como se fosse uma função, mas não é...
Não se esqueça, q uma rotina (void) não retorna nenhum valor...
O que você poderia fazer é realizar um if com essa variavel, do tipo, se essa variável é >= 0, then....
OBS: O que retornaria um valor seria uma função, ex:
private int CadastraUsuario
{
// executa algum código
return rowsAffected;
}
Espero ter ajudado..abs,
Leonardo Hickstein
Hickstein Lab
#421385 Página: Cadastro
Posted by hicksteinlab on 07/08/2004, 20:31 in .NET
poderia postar seu código para que nós possamos analisar?
Espero resposta...abs,
Leonardo Hickstein
Hickstein Lab
#417708 Duvidas
Posted by hicksteinlab on 01/08/2004, 23:53 in .NET
um código para aplicação desktop, pode ser escrito por qualquer linguagem suportada pela plataforma .net, ou seja, um arquivo pode ser em C#, outro em VB.NET, pois quando compiladas, ambas liguagens passam a se entender, mas um código escrito para aplicação desktop vai funcionar apenas para desktop, e um código para aplicação web apenas para web, pois os códigos serão diferentes...mas repito, você pode ter um controle de usuário em C#, e suas páginas em VB.NET e ainda uma classe e C++
Espero ter ajudado...abs,
Leonardo Hickstein
Hickstein Lab
#416725 Armazenar Em Variáveis Diferentes
Posted by hicksteinlab on 31/07/2004, 04:37 in .NET
1) Sim, você pode colocá-lo no evento Page_Load;
2) o o bloco Try funciona assim, ou tudo ou nada, ou seja, ele "TRY" "tenta" executar o que tiver no bloco try, se algum erro acontecer, ele vai para o "CATCH" "pegar" os erros, e fazer algo, como exibir uma mensagem amigável, e também há o "FINALLY" "finalmente", que independente de der certo ou errado, tanto no Try como no Catch, o Finally eh executado, comumente usado para fechar objetos!
3) o Try...Catch...Finally não é um rotina, ou sub-rotina, ou uma função, ele é o chamado, bloco de tratamente de erros, e vai estar contido em uma rotina, sub-rotina ou função, ou classe e assim vai!
Espero ter ajudado...abs,
Leonardo Hickstein
Hickstein Lab
#415809 Armazenar Em Variáveis Diferentes
Posted by hicksteinlab on 29/07/2004, 20:03 in .NET
não pude testar mais ai vai uma solução de "cabeça":
Dim objCmd As SqlCommand
Try
objConn.Open
' para variável 'A'
strSQL = "SELECT COUNT (*) FROM Gabarito WHERE resposta= 'A'"
objCmd = New SqlCommand(strSQL, objConn)
intA As Integer = objCmd.ExecuteScalar
' para variável 'B'
strSQL = "SELECT COUNT (*) FROM Gabarito WHERE resposta= 'C'"
objCmd = New SqlCommand(strSQL, objConn)
intB As Integer = objCmd.ExecuteScalar
' para variável 'C'
strSQL = "SELECT COUNT (*) FROM Gabarito WHERE resposta= 'C'"
objCmd = New SqlCommand(strSQL, objConn)
intC As Integer = objCmd.ExecuteScalar
Catch Ex As SqlException
Response.Write("Erro acessando BD!")
Finally
objConn.Close
End Try
Tente aí, pena não poder testar antes, mas se tiver alguma dúvida poste novamente...espero que de certo
Abs,
Leonardo Hickstein
Hickstein Lab
#415229 Pobrema Com Findcontrol()
Posted by hicksteinlab on 28/07/2004, 23:47 in .NET
tente assim:
string strID = ( (TextBox) e.Item.FindControl("TextBox3") ).Text;
Espero ter ajudado, Abs,
Leonardo Hickstein
Hickstein Lab
#414113 Tutorial De Enquete
Posted by hicksteinlab on 27/07/2004, 13:52 in .NET
te aconselho o seguinte, você pode usar aquele código da enquete no site da MSDN, e gravar o been_here_before em um cookie que expira em 24hrs ou então gravar ou modificar no banco para "yes"...
Espero ter ajudado,
Leonardo Hickstein
Hickstein Lab
#413677 Tutorial De Enquete
Posted by hicksteinlab on 26/07/2004, 22:58 in .NET
eu também já procurei muito na net sobre tutoriais ou artigos sobre como fazer uma enquete em asp.net, realmente só achei uma, muito boa até, que resolveu meu problema...estou sem o link em mãos, mas se você for ao site da MSDN Brasil, na seção artigos ou tutorias, escreva "enquete", na busca, que você irá achar!
Abraços,
Leonardo Hickstein
Hickstein Lab
#409360 Conversão Do Formata Dd/mm/yyyy Para Mm/dd/yyyy
Posted by hicksteinlab on 20/07/2004, 17:08 in .NET
1) Você pode, na sua diretiva "Page", adiocionar o parâmetro Culture="en-US", ou
2) DateTime.ToString("MM/dd/yyyy");
Espero tê-lo ajudado,
Leonardo Hickstein
Hickstein Lab
#404023 Dúvidas No Blog
Posted by hicksteinlab on 13/07/2004, 23:49 in HTML, CSS e Metodologias
Creio que o problema que você está tendo eh com o CSS, sabe..., eh soh configurar corretamente seus atributos "style", diria mais especificamente, nos atributos "left" e "top".
Que tal você dar uma olhada no site www.tableless.com.br, lá você encontra um material sobre técnicas de CSS
Abs,
Espero tê-la ajudado,
Leonardo Hickstein
#354275 Listbox
Posted by hicksteinlab on 01/05/2004, 01:39 in .NET
Veja se é isso que você está precisando:
'Eventos disparados por botões Sub MoveParaListBox2(sender As Object, e As EventArgs) ListBox2.SelectedIndex = -1 ListBox2.Items.Add(ListBox1.SelectedItem) ListBox1.Items.Remove(ListBox1.SelectedItem) End Sub Sub MoveParaListBox1(sender As Object, e As EventArgs) ListBox1.SelectedIndex = -1 ListBox1.Items.Add(ListBox2.SelectedItem) ListBox2.Items.Remove(ListBox2.SelectedItem) End Sub
Espero ter o ajudado,
- Fórum WMO
- → hicksteinlab's Content
- Privacy Policy
- Regras ·